e& UAE Unveils Autonomous Network Strategy to Accelerate AI-Driven Telecom Operations

e& UAE has unveiled a strategic blueprint for autonomous networks, outlining its vision for AI-driven telecommunications infrastructure capable of automating network operations, improving service performance and supporting the growing demands of the digital economy.

The initiative positions autonomous networking as a cornerstone of future telecom operations, as operators worldwide seek to leverage artificial intelligence, automation and advanced analytics to manage increasingly complex communications environments.

The blueprint reflects a broader industry shift toward self-managing networks that can optimize performance, predict issues and execute operational decisions with minimal human intervention.

AI Becomes Central to Network Operations

As telecommunications networks evolve to support 5G, cloud services, IoT deployments and AI-powered applications, traditional operational models are becoming increasingly difficult to scale.

Autonomous networks use artificial intelligence and machine learning to automate tasks such as traffic management, fault detection, capacity planning and service optimization. By reducing reliance on manual processes, operators can improve efficiency while delivering more consistent customer experiences.

For e& UAE, the strategy aims to create networks capable of responding dynamically to changing conditions, enabling faster issue resolution and more efficient use of infrastructure resources.

The approach aligns with the growing adoption of AI across the telecommunications sector, where operators are increasingly integrating intelligent automation into both network management and customer-facing services.

Telecom Industry Moves Toward Zero-Touch Operations

The concept of autonomous networking is gaining momentum globally as operators seek to move toward “zero-touch” operations, where many routine management tasks are handled automatically.

This evolution is expected to improve operational efficiency, reduce costs and accelerate the rollout of new services.

By integrating AI into core network functions, operators can gain deeper visibility into network behavior while improving predictive maintenance and service quality.

For enterprises, autonomous networks can help support mission-critical applications that require high levels of reliability and performance.
